Excellent experience! For an extra R100 compared to its neighbors, this is the one to stop at, the entrance waiting room resembles a library and after dinner aperitif area, great to just relax in, much like the full bar in a 19th century style has charm and is quite hospitable, old school refinery. There are cottages surrounding the pool area, and in front more traditional 'stoop facing the street' accommodation. lovely! The rooms are huge with high ceilings, antique furniture and very clean. All the usual amenities are available Tv, electric blanket, kettle etc. The restaurant is a la carte and resembles fine dinning without the shirt and tie, or having to pull her chair out. Try the springbok steak or ask for a group set menu, great after an excursion to the national parks treasured view two roads up. Plenty secure parking for your vehicle, whatever the size. Oh and very hospitable, ask the owner about the areas history... Very interesting just like the building built in 1818. I'll be back...

Sadly Karoopark Guest House failed to live up to expectations. We stayed in room 9 which was looking rather tired and neglected in several areas. Facilities in the bathroom lacked a storage shelf in the shower and generally could do with being upgraded. Room had no blackout curtains, internet was not working so no television, room and sitting area had no form of heating when cold. Housekeeping in our room was very basic consisting of poor make up of bed, no washing of cups or glasses after making drinks.|Generally staff were very good - owners failed to show any interest in guests unless you were in a large party booking. Its a very tranquil, neat place with a green, lush yard. The staff are friendly and helpful. Their breakfast was nice and the fruit was pretty fresh. I enjoyed tgeir grilled lamb chops for dinner. I was allocated a room with 2 single beds and a shower. The mattress on ny bed was too hard. The room was smallish but clean. It also had a little bar fridge which is a bargain on hot days - to keep your drinks cold. There is ample, secure parking space inside the premises. I would definitely come back here if allocated a room with a larger, softer mattress. Otherwise it was pleasant staying here.
